Output 28322995d19e029f4bc26ba356d5ec92db8a7bcfeddf8cf4e27af88d0a5c5161:4

value
35856111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761f79e1c89d42c3b03faeacf6b0fe55aacf0bd3 OP_EQUAL
address
MJfjg4fhn8BsBeRHujhEnB52FXSJ6D7QvS
transaction
28322995d19e029f4bc26ba356d5ec92db8a7bcfeddf8cf4e27af88d0a5c5161
spent
true